Ana Belén Tapia Appointed Vice-Chairwoman of the Monitoring Commission

Summary by El Universo
With six votes in favour and four against, legislator Ana Belén Tapia, representative of Napo Province for the ruling National Democratic Action (NDA) party, was appointed vice-president of the National Assembly's Monitoring Commission.
